Emerging Trends in Photovoltaic Technology
Recent developments in the Dutch solar sector reveal three key advancements:
1. Bifacial Panel Integration
Many installers now combine polycrystalline modules with bifacial technology, boosting energy yield by up to 20% through rear-side light absorption.
2. Smart Energy Management Systems
New hybrid inverters enable seamless integration with home batteries and EV charging stations - a game changer for energy-conscious households.
3. Floating Solar Farms
Innovative projects like the 27MW Bomhofsplas array demonstrate how polycrystalline panels perform exceptionally well in aquatic environments.

FAQ: Solar Panel Solutions in the Netherlands
- Q: How long do polycrystalline panels last in Dutch weather? A: Most systems maintain 80% efficiency after 25 years
- Q: What government incentives are available? A: VAT reduction schemes and net metering programs
- Q: Can panels withstand hail storms? A: Modern panels meet IEC 61215 impact resistance standards
